Marshall Islands precipitation in November

In Marshall Islands in November precipitation ranges from heavy in Kwajalein with 281 mm of rainfall to heavy in Majuro with 323 mm of rainfall.

Legend heavy rainfall high moderate low almost none
Heavy rainfall has been defined as more than 160 mm precipitation. High: 90 mm to 160 mm. Moderate: 30 mm to 90 mm. Low: 5 mm to 30 mm.

  • How much rainfall does Marshall Islands receive in November?
  • If you're considering a trip to Marshall Islands, remember that November falls within the rainy season. In Majuro, the month of November typically brings a significant amount of rain, with averages close to 323 mm. As a result, you can expect quick-changing weather patterns and numerous showers.

  • What is the wettest city in November in Marshall Islands?
  • Based on our records, Majuro is the location with the highest average precipitation, receiving about 323 mm.

  • What is the driest city in November in Marshall Islands?
  • Our figures indicate that Kwajalein receives the least rainfall, averaging just 281 mm.
